Asthma Camp
Asthma Camp is a fun and educational summer camp where children with moderate to severe asthma learn to better manage and control their disease. Highly skilled doctors, nurses and respiratory therapists provide medical supervision and instruction while campers enjoy traditional summer camp activities. » More
Freedom From Smoking
Freedom From Smoking (FFS) is a state-of-the-art cessation program developed to help smokers at all stages of the quitting process. People who use the program are six times more likely to be smoke-free one year later than those who quit on their own. » More

Not On Tobacco (N-O-T)
Not On Tobacco (N-O-T) is a state-of-the-science, school-based program that provides assistance to teens who wish to quit smoking. The program covers the entire quitting process, including the prevention of relapses. » More
Teens Against Tobacco Use TATU
Teens Against Tobacco Use (TATU) is a program that allows students ages 14-17 to mentor youngsters about the dangers of smoking. Peer-led programs such as TATU are an effective method in reducing tobacco use among youth. » More

TB Control Incentives Program
The Tuberculosis (TB) Control Incentive Program administered by the American Lung Association of Wisconsin is designed to assist you with the treatment of tuberculosis clients by providing funding to purchase incentives and enablers that will encourage clients to complete therapy. » More
